diff options
author | 2017-03-17 09:50:46 -0400 | |
---|---|---|
committer | 2017-03-17 14:27:33 +0000 | |
commit | e88a1cb20e6b4c9f099070112225a88693a4630b (patch) | |
tree | c35774aef5ec56eb377d5bb9ed1ea2694e72efc6 /include/utils/SkNoDrawCanvas.h | |
parent | a392dbaa998e9f137103f7a7e86f89cb7224552f (diff) |
Revert[2] "More SkVertices implementation work""
The fix was to release the array of vertices in the picturerecorder
destructor (where we also release textblobs etc.
This reverts commit 1eb3fef136bc75bd8e8ed717ec7c5d4ab26def62.
BUG=skia:
Change-Id: I3bf4acd6ad209205b0832a3cb7f94cd89dfcefc5
Reviewed-on: https://skia-review.googlesource.com/9826
Reviewed-by: Mike Reed <reed@google.com>
Commit-Queue: Mike Reed <reed@google.com>
Diffstat (limited to 'include/utils/SkNoDrawCanvas.h')
-rw-r--r-- | include/utils/SkNoDrawCanvas.h | 5 |
1 files changed, 1 insertions, 4 deletions
diff --git a/include/utils/SkNoDrawCanvas.h b/include/utils/SkNoDrawCanvas.h index 14b85549f4..75c15b201e 100644 --- a/include/utils/SkNoDrawCanvas.h +++ b/include/utils/SkNoDrawCanvas.h @@ -68,10 +68,7 @@ protected: const SkPaint*) override {} void onDrawVertices(VertexMode, int, const SkPoint[], const SkPoint[], const SkColor[], SkBlendMode, const uint16_t[], int, const SkPaint&) override {} - void onDrawVerticesObject(sk_sp<SkVertices> vertices, SkBlendMode mode, const SkPaint& paint, - uint32_t flags) override { - this->onDrawVerticesObjectFallback(std::move(vertices), mode, paint, flags); - } + void onDrawVerticesObject(const SkVertices*, SkBlendMode, const SkPaint&) override {} void onDrawAtlas(const SkImage*, const SkRSXform[], const SkRect[], const SkColor[], int, SkBlendMode, const SkRect*, const SkPaint*) override {} |